OBD-II

OBD-II diagnostics for vehicles are made using sensors that detect problems with vehicles. These sensors send abnormal data to the engine controller unit (ECU), who stores it as a Diagnostic Trouble Code. This code is a string of numbers and letters that determine the nature and cause of the problem. OBD-II codes are applicable to all areas of a vehicle, such as the chassis, body powertrain, network, and.

310300814_438157535072560_441431797686435441_nlow.jpgOBD-II vehicle diagnostics can be completed with the help of various tools. These tools can vary from simple tools for consumers to more sophisticated OEM dealership tools and vehicle telematic systems. Hand-held scanners and fault code readers are among the most basic tools. But, there are sophisticated and rugged devices available in the market.

A scanner tool can read diagnostic trouble codes from the computer system of a vehicle. It can also read the VIN of the vehicle. OBD-II scanners also come with a feature which permits them to read codes from any protocol. A mechanic can read and interpret the data and provide you with all the information regarding your vehicle's problem.

OBD-II vehicle diagnostics can help you save costs on repairs and enhance your car's performance. They can also provide information about the health of key engine components and emission control. With this information, a technician can identify problems quickly and efficiently.

CANBUS

A scan tool can be used to examine the entire system of the vehicle that is CANBUS compatible. This will let you see what modules are supposed to be connected and which are not. This could indicate an issue with the wiring or the communication.

CAN bus faults have many symptoms, including partial or total loss of vehicle functionality. These faults can often cause an audible warning or a visual sign for the vehicle operator. Software malfunctions could also be a possible cause. A CAN bus problem can also result in a malfunctioning charging system, low battery voltage, or incorrect connections.

A low resistance reading on a port for CAN is an indication of a defective device for CAN or a damaged wiring harness. Some CAN devices may contain an internal termination resistor which switches on and off as the unit is powered up. The manufacturer's service data should contain information on the internal termination resistors, which are specific to a Can device.

The CAN bus protocol is a message-based protocol created to connect automobile components. Multiplex electrical wiring is used to save copper while allowing communication between vehicles. Each device transmits information in a frame which is received by all devices on the network.

Check engine light

The Check Engine light on your car could be an indication of a serious issue. It is imperative to take your vehicle to a mechanic for an orange or red light. The sooner you get it fixed, the less expensive it will cost. This light could also be accompanied with other signs, like a strange engine noise.

Regardless of the cause regardless of the reason Check Engine Light is meant to warn you of a problem in your vehicle. This icon with the shape of an engine is typically located in the instrument cluster, and is activated when the car's onboard computer detects the presence of a problem. This indicator could be activated due to a variety of issues however, sometimes it's as simple as a gas cap that isn't tight enough and a faulty spark plug.

Another possible cause for a Check Engine Light is a issue with the exhaust system. This light could be caused by an EGR (exhaust gas recirculation valve). While these valves aren't in need of regular maintenance, they do become blocked with carbon and need to be replaced. A malfunctioning EGR valve could result in a greater amount of emissions. After you have fixed the issue, your car will automatically turn off the light. If your car's CEL remains on for longer than three days, you might want to check again or manually reset the light.

A diagnostic scan will reveal the codes that cause your Check Engine light to blink. Sometimes, a simple scan using an easy scan tool can reveal the exact problem. For more complex issues you'll require professional scanners.

Trouble codes

DTCs (diagnostic trouble codes) are codes that can be used to pinpoint the cause of problems in your vehicle. These codes range in length between one and five characters, and can be used to represent anything from warning lights to malfunctioning engine. These codes can be used for troubleshooting and pinpointing the root of issues.

DTCs can be used to determine the cause of problems with vehicles, but not all of them are serious. Sometimes, trouble codes can indicate that the sensor circuit is out of range or that there is a problem with the emissions control system. After you have identified what is causing the issue then you can begin to figure out the solution. It is important to understand where the trouble codes are located on your vehicle. DTCs are usually stored in the Engine Control Module or Powertrain Control Module.

Trouble codes for diagnostics are important for determining what kind of problem is causing the problem. They can help a mechanic to identify the cause of problems and determine what repairs are necessary. For example, the check engine light might indicate a problem with your circuitry for the fuel level sensor. It may also indicate an issue with the emissions idle control system. In other instances, the light could be a sign of something more serious like gas caps that have become loose.

Some of these codes could be critical and require immediate repairs. If you have more than one DTC in your vehicle, it's crucial to determine which is more urgent and needs to fix.

Checking fuel supply

Vehicle diagnostics can be complicated due to the importance of pressure and volume. A malfunctioning fuel system can cause diagnostic trouble codes to appear on your vehicle's computer. These codes can be interpreted using an electronic code reader or scan tool. Many auto parts shops offer codes reading services for free of cost. You can also purchase cheap code reading devices for smartphones. Once you have an idea of what to look out for you can examine the fuel pressure.

Checking the fuel supply is a step-by-step procedure. It's fairly easy to carry out. You can listen for a hum inside the fuel tank to check it. It should last around two seconds before stopping. If you hear a sound, it's likely that the electrical circuit in your fuel pump is operating properly. If it's not, you'll need to perform additional diagnostic tests.

In addition to monitoring the fuel pressure in addition, you can examine the MAF sensor for leaks and clogged fuel injectors. The P0171/P0174 code could be due to an MAF sensor that is dirty. If you're unsure of which part you need to replace then you can use a volumetric efficiency chart or calculator to determine which one.

The pressure of your fuel is vital to the health of your vehicle. If the pressure is high but the flow is poor then you'll be unable to start the vehicle. A voltmeter reading that indicates low pressure could be a sign of poor fuel flow. With a scope and amp clamp, you can test the voltage and amps of the injector's pulses.

Checking air filter

If your car's filter is dirty, it could cause a variety of problems, from sudden acceleration, to fuel that has not been burned and miniature explosions. A thorough inspection of the air filter can help you detect the problems early and you could even spot them before your car shows any signs. Start by removing any fasteners that connect the air intake box together. These fasteners could be clipsor screws or even hex nuts. Once the fasteners are gone, you can pull the air filter out.

Make sure that the filter is clean and seated properly. This will enable the filter to carry out its tasks properly. The engine may not function properly if the filter is dirty. It might also not give precise readings. The air filter is typically situated near the engine or near the front of the vehicle.

A clogged air filter can cause the check engine light to come on. This indicator could also indicate a more serious problem. A blocked air filter can cause too much fuel to be burned , restricting the flow of air into your engine. The check engine light may also be activated by excessive carbon deposits. A skilled mechanic will determine the cause of the check engine light.

Change the air filter is an essential component of a car's engine. It prevents dust and impurities from getting into the air in the engine. This leads to cleaner combustion. If the airflow is not properly maintained, the engine will have difficulty starting, running or increasing.
